**Ticket: Export signature check failing on retry**

The nightly Fernwick exports failed signature verification after the retry job reran them with a stale manifest. Re-queue the failed batches from the Driftline console, then re-sign each bundle before pushing to the archive tier. Use the export signing key that follows to complete verification.

signing key of bagap-yawep = bky13_TbfT6ZMUoGJo2

## Pricing: The Corvane Line — Managers Only

Welcome aboard. Quick primer: Corvane pricing runs on a three-tier model — Base, Plus, and Studio — with annual uplifts capped at 6%. We held Base flat last year to defend share against Pellwick's budget range, and it worked. Plus is where the margin lives, so protect it. Discounting above 15% needs director sign-off. The next move we're weighing is laid out in the confidential note below.

board note of bahif-yajef: Only 9 of the 120 pilot accounts renewed Oliwyn, so a churn review is set for January 1.

Release checklist — deep-link routing, Lanternly mobile app: verify universal links resolve on both platforms, confirm legacy scheme fallbacks still route to onboarding, and run the route-map diff against the prior release. Any new route requires QA sign-off. Once verified, attach the routing bundle's build token directly below this item.

session token of tajef-bageg = htk21_5d90d574934f3ccae6437

BRIEFING — Regional Sales Review, Westmoor Territory

Quick one for finance ahead of the leadership session. Westmoor came in 8% over target, mostly thanks to the Larkspun bundle refresh. Norfell lagged — two stalled deals, both expected to close next quarter. Headcount asks are modest: one field rep, one analyst. Full numbers in the deck. For context on where this is heading, see the note below.

board note of kageg-bahof: The renewal with Holwynax Holdings closes at $2 million a year, 5 percent below the last contract. Project Ulaath slips by two quarters because of the supplier delay.